Connection of headphones (commercially available)

Headphones (commercially available) can be connected.

Headphone terminal

Headphones

Note:

-When the headphones are connected, no sound can be heard from the monitor speakers.

Connecting the monitor to a power source

Turning the power on

1. Turn on the main power of the monitor.

Main power switch

-When switching the main power switch on and off, always wait for an interval of at least 5 seconds. Rapid switching may result in malfunction.

2.Press the monitor's power button.

3.Turn on the computer.

When a signal is input from the computer, the power LED lights up green, and the screen is displayed. (After power is turned on, it may take a little time until the screen is displayed.)

Note for LL-171G:

-If the input terminal to which the computer is connected has not been selected, the screen will not be displayed. If necessary, perform input terminal switching. (p.16)

Notes:

-When using an analog signal, perform an automatic screen adjustment under the following conditions (p.19):

-Using the monitor for the first time.

-After having changed the system settings during use.

-When using the LL-171G with a digital connection, automatic screen adjustment is unnecessary.

-Depending on the type of computer or OS, you may need to install the monitor set-up information on your system. (p.28)

-When connecting to a notebook, if the notebook computer's screen is set to display at the same time, the MS-DOS screen may not display properly. In this case, change the setting to display only the LCD monitor.
